Last year, Marc Christian Nazario placed 5th over-all in the 14 and Under category. A prodigy and a veteran campaigner in the local and international tournaments, I am really expecting him to land within the top three or probably take the gold in his age group this coming National Age Group Tourney.
With his year round training and tournament games plus the arrival of his Syrian IM coach, I would be one of those fans who'd be delighted to know he gets the top plum! Watch the game below as he dominates his oppponent over the board:
